Plants that do not have system of tubes are called?

Plants that do not have a system of tubes for transporting water and nutrients are called non-vascular plants. These plants rely on osmosis and diffusion for internal transport of materials. Some examples include mosses, liverworts, and hornworts.


When plants with tubes that can move fluid within themselves?

Plants with tubes that can move fluid within themselves are known as vascular plants. These tubes, called xylem and phloem, transport water, nutrients, and sugars throughout the plant to support growth and metabolism. Vascular plants include ferns, flowering plants, conifers, and many others.

What are the tubes in the stems of plants called?

there are two types of vessels or tubes in the stem of a plant; xylem vessels transport water and minerals from the roots, up through the stem of the plant. they are made up of dead cells, and in trees they are seen as wood phloem tubes carry the sap (sugars, cytoplasm, hormones, etc.) from the leaves to wherever they are needed for growth or repairs.


What are the transportation tubes found in plants called?

There are two types of transportation tubes in plants called the xylem and the phloem. The xylem transports water and minerals throughout the plant, while the phloem transports the sugars and other molecules made in the leaves due to photosynthesis throughout the plant.

What plants that have conducting tubes?

Plants that have conducting tubes for water and nutrients are called vascular plants. These include ferns, gymnosperms (such as conifers), and angiosperms (flowering plants). The conducting tubes are known as xylem (for water and minerals) and phloem (for sugars and other organic compounds).
